| 520 | _aThis volume presents state of the art of methods that can be useful for both basic and translational researchers to conduct chemoprevention preclinical studies. Written in the highly successful Methods in Molecular Biology series format, chapters include introductions to their respective topics, lists of the necessary materials and reagents, step-by-step, readily reproducible laboratory protocols, and tips on troubleshooting and avoiding known pitfalls. Authoritative and practical, Cancer Chemoprevention: Methods and Protocols aims to ensure successful results in the further study of this vital field. | ||
